def _enumerate_full_name_representations(self): """ Enumerate a person's full name in the common ways full names can be represented. Includes common nicknames for the person's first name and middle name/initial when the person has a middle name. Full names generated are intended to be compared to full names obtained from API services, email servers, etc. For example: Variants of *James Herbert Bond* include, but aren't limited to the following: * James Bond * Bond James * James Herbert Bond * James H Bond * Jimmy Bond * Bond, James * Bond, James Herbert * Bond, Jim Herbert .. todo:: * Migrate to use the `get_[f]ml_name_variations()` functions. * Remove some of the noise via nickname probability mappings :return: None """ fml_patterns = [ '{f} {m} {l}', '{m} {l} {f}', '{l} {f} {m}', '{f}, {m}, {l}', '{m}, {l}, {f}', '{l}, {f}, {m}', '{l}, {f} {m}' ] fl_patterns = ['{f} {l}', '{l} {f}', '{l}, {f}'] first_name, middle_name, last_name = self.person.first_name, None, self.person.last_name if self.person.has_middle_name(): middle_name = self.person.middle_name # TODO: Remove some of the noise via nickname probability mappings # Build a list of potential first names. E.g. Robert > Bob or Johnathan > John > Jon nick_names = retrieve_nicknames_for_name(first_name) first_names = [first_name] first_names.extend(nick_names) # Generate our list of potential full name variants generated_names = set() for first in first_names: # Add full first/last name variants for pattern in fl_patterns: generated_names.add(pattern.format(f=first, l=last_name)) # Add full first/middle/last name variants, including middle initial variants for pattern in fml_patterns if middle_name else []: generated_names.add(pattern.format(f=first, m=middle_name, l=last_name)) generated_names.add(pattern.format(f=first, m=middle_name[0], l=last_name)) self.full_name_representations = generated_names
